Landlord Document 05 Company Let Agreement

Description

The Company Let Agreement is a specialist tenancy agreement used when a company, rather than an individual, rents a property. This agreement is not an Assured Shorthold Tenancy (AST) under the Housing Act 1988, as the tenant is a corporate entity rather than an individual. It provides landlords and agents with a legally robust framework to manage company lets with clarity and compliance.

📘Purpose & Use Case

This document formalizes arrangements where a property is let to a company for employee accommodation or business-related purposes. It ensures both parties understand their legal obligations, including rent payment terms, property maintenance, and termination clauses. As company lets fall outside standard residential tenancy protections, this agreement is essential for setting clear contractual terms.

📘When Should It Be Used?

Use this agreement whenever a property is being rented to a company, whether for long-term employee housing or short-term corporate use. It is particularly important because company lets are governed by contract law, not housing legislation, meaning terms must be explicitly agreed upon to avoid disputes.
